[Great, Dick hates when random dimensional travel happens. But at least he managed to shove Damian out of the way of the ray gun. Which is good because he still has no idea when he is and Gotham won't be unprotected, but bad because Damian in charge of Gotham? Not a good thing. Hopefully Tim will come and visit home, or Steph will take charge, or something.
Meanwhile, Dick has to figure out how to get home.
The streets are configured like Gotham, though the technology levels are a lot higher than what Dick's used to. But if there's Gotham, there's likely a Wayne Manor, and under it, probably a Batcave. It's worth checking out anyway.
The secret entrance is where it usually is, so he bypasses Wayne Manor entirely, but once he gets inside....
He has to stop and look around. Everything's so different. He draws to a stop in front of the display cases. He's used to just the one, for Jason. This is... more.
He pulls off the cowl as he looks, the cape weighing heavy on his shoulders, deep in thought.]
